Jean-Henri Merle d’Aubigné was a Swiss Protestant minister who wrote in 1827 about the practice of having family devotions. One thought of his in particular stands out to me: “The great matter is that God be not forgotten under your roof.”
This is really what Haven Ministries has been about for the past 85 years—that God be not forgotten under your roof. Its radio broadcasts, daily devotional words, book and music offerings, prayer ministry—all of these have sought for decades to be sure that the Lord is at the center of your home and your heart.
I remember being a kid sitting around the big console radio at my grandma’s house to hear The Haven of Rest show. We heard the ship’s horn, the ringing of eight bells, The Haven of Rest song, and First Mate Bob with his message about Jesus. I never would have guessed that the Lord would prepare my heart some 40 years later to be an integral part of this ministry. Since 2008 I have been working with Haven to help tell the great story that’s all about Jesus. May He never be forgotten under your roof!
